All-suite hotel close to Grand Central and the Empire State Building
Space is the name of the game at this 14-story Murray Hill hotel. All rooms are suites with full kitchens, so guests have plenty of room to spread out. The hotel has a fitness center and offers free Wi-Fi in the lobby. The location is near the Empire State Building and Grand Central and convenient to Midtown businesses and tourist attractions.

Location

The hotel is a short walk from Grand Central Terminal, Bryant Park, the Empire State Building and the United Nations. Fifth Avenue is just four blocks away.

Rooms

The 118 rooms are all suites with full kitchens. Microwaves and toasters are available upon request. All suites have dining tables and desks. Junior and one-bedroom suites also have sofa beds. Expect patterned bedspreads and curtains, dark carpeting and upholstered furniture. Rooms have cable TV, and Wi-Fi (fees apply) is available.

Features

Guest can take advantage of free Wi-Fi in the lobby. The fitness center is open daily from 6 a.m. to 10 p.m. The hotel is affiliated with a self-park parking garage around the corner (fees apply).

Dining

Travelers have a wide variety of dining options close to the hotel. The lower level of Grand Central Terminal boasts a large food court with options ranging from Jamaican cuisine to barbecue to specialty cupcakes.

Murray Hill East Hotel Rooms

One Bedroom Suite
Full One Bedroom Suite with either a king or two double beds, separate living room with a queen sofa bed, fully equipped kitchen, full bathroom, dining table, desk, dresser and cable television.
Studio Suite
Features one king, one queen or two double beds, a fully equipped kitchen, full bathroom, dining table, desk, dresser and cable television.
Junior Suite
Features and L-shaped room with a queen bed in the bedroom and a pull out queen sofa bed in the living room, a fully equipped kitchen, full bathroom, dining table, desk, dresser and cable television.

Clean & Welcoming - Worthy of a Look

Annually, my family (self, husband, son) go to NYC for 24hrs b/t Christmas & New Year's to look at the store windows & eat at some favorite restaurants. I booked a room at Murray Hill Suites Hotel based on price & location. It was easy to walk to all the stores with the cool holiday window displays, so location was great! The doorman was just wonderful & helpful and so was the front desk staff, though we didn't need any special services. We did get a nice surprise when we checked in - our room was upgraded and we ended up in one of the 3 suites on the top floor with a full kitchen, separate bedroom with 2 queen size beds large living room/dining room area and a balcony. My son was so enthralled with the place and wished we could've stayed longer. The only drawback I found in the room was the channel selection on cable/TV was small. There didn't seem to be any children's channels. Luckily my son likes Discovery, TLC & the History Channel. Not that we were in our room for a whole lot of time, so the outdated furniture & wallpaper in the kitchen didn't bother us at all. I would definitely recommend this hotel & consider staying there again, as long as the person looking for a recommendation doesn't mind that there is no hotel restaurant nor on-site parking. Parking was only about a block away, so not too inconvenient.
